Course Content

• Understanding Color Temperature & its Measurement
• Color Temperature in Photography & Videography
• Kelvin Scale & its Application in Color Correction
• White Balance Adjustment Techniques for Accurate Color
• Color Temperature Effects on Mood & Atmosphere
• Mixing and Matching Color Temperatures for Creative Effects
• Color Temperature Calibration for Consistent Results
• Advanced Color Temperature Workflow in Post-Production
• Troubleshooting Color Temperature Issues in Different Media
• Color Temperature and Lighting Design
